Bemis Donates Toilet Seats For 4th of July Festivities

July 1, 2010

ARTICLE TOOLS
EmailEmailPrintPrintReprintsReprintsshareShare



Bemis Manufacturing Co. will participate in the Redneck Games at the Independence Day festival of Cape Girardeau, MO, by donating a dozen lidless open-front toilet seats to be used in the games. A few high-end showroom Bemis seats were also donated as prizes.  

U.S.A. Veterans Commander Rodger Brown approached Bemis Manufacturing with a request for donated seats for use in a newly created game — the toilet seat toss.  

“This event is tied to supporting our veterans, so it’s a worthy cause,” said Bob Davis, Bemis director of marketing, who added that it was the first time he received a request for seats to be used in a toilet seat toss. “We got quite a kick out of the concept,” he said.  

The toilet seat toss, played with Bemis open-front seats that are tossed like horseshoes, joins other innovations created by Brown and his colleagues for this year’s festival. To learn more about the festival, visit http://www.usa-veterans.org/events.php.
